
Prime Minister Narendra Modi will inaugurate two new Delhi Metro corridors on March 8: the 12.3 km Majlis Park-Maujpur-Babarpur section of the Pink Line and the 9.92 km Deepali Chowk-Majlis Park extension of the Magenta Line. These projects, costing over Rs 18,300 crore, complete India's first fully operational Ring Metro and include one of the highest elevated sections in the network. Modi will also lay the foundation stone for three new corridors under Phase V-A, enhancing connectivity across Delhi and NCR.
